HARTSELLE, Ala. (WIAT) – Although swimming is fun, it’s also an important skill that can save lives.
Six-year-old Gram Flowers has been swimming for three years. It’s a skill that his family is crediting for Flowers’ grand-dad Carl being alive Friday morning.
Recently Gram and grand-dad were having fun on a jet ski, but a wave flipped the pair off. Gram was okay, but his grand-dad was not. He was face down in the water, but fortunately Gram knew what to do.
“Him being able to swim and keeping his little head straight and making sure I was okay, I think that’s why I’m here,” said Carl Flowers.
Carl Flowers said Gram flipped him over in the water so he could breathe. Gram then called for help.
